How to use or fill out the Local Public Agency Section 4(f) Compliance Worksheet (parks/refuges Only) Form Updated: Sept online

This guide provides comprehensive instructions on how to complete the Local Public Agency Section 4(f) Compliance Worksheet, specifically designed for parks and refuges. Whether you are familiar with legal documents or not, this step-by-step approach will help you navigate through the form with ease.

Follow the steps to successfully fill out the compliance worksheet.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the worksheet and access it in your chosen editing tool.
  2. Begin by addressing the initial question regarding publicly owned or leased lands within your project limits. Circle ‘YES’ or ‘NO’ and provide relevant details regarding any public land that may be affected.
  3. If you answered ‘YES’ to the first question, include a brief description of the public land: its nature, location, name, owner, and specify if it is used for public recreation or as a wildlife refuge. Attach any pertinent photographs if possible.
  4. Proceed to describe whether the project involves a change of land ownership. Tick the appropriate option and provide explanations where needed.
  5. Detail how the project may impact public park and recreation lands, including any anticipated disruptions or changes.
  6. Indicate if mitigation measures have been developed to minimize adverse impacts on the qualified resource, and summarize these measures. Include a statement from the park/refuge manager expressing agreement with these measures.
  7. Quantify the impact on public lands by filling in the specified areas for right-of-way, permanent easements, and temporary construction easements.
  8. Complete the programmatic threshold questions. Answer each with ‘YES’ or ‘NO’, as applicable.
  9. Answer questions regarding proximity impacts and whether the project requires an Environmental Impact Statement (EIS). Provide additional details as needed.
  10. If applicable, mention any federal funds that have improved the public land and attach necessary documentation.
  11. Indicate whether the park/refuge manager objects to the proposed impacts and provide the appropriate attachments.
  12. Discuss feasible alternatives to the project that may avoid impacts on the park/refuge, if any. Provide rationale if alternatives do not exist.
  13. Outline consequences of not completing the project to highlight its importance.
  14. Describe any offsetting measures being taken to minimize the impact to the park/refuge.
  15. Ensure that coordination with federal, state, and local officials has occurred regarding park/refuge jurisdiction, and document your responses.
  16. Finalize the section on temporary construction easements, elaborating on any comments or explanations regarding their applicability.
